5. Children's Personal Information

Stable Flow allows a parent or guardian to create and manage a linked account for a minor rider. We rely on the parent or guardian (as the person with legal capacity) to provide any necessary consent for that minor's information to be processed, in line with POPIA's special protections for children's personal information. Tenants using Parent & Minor Accounts are responsible for obtaining that consent; we do not knowingly collect information directly from a minor without a parent or guardian's involvement.

7. Cross-Border Transfers

Some of our service providers may process or store information outside South Africa. Where this happens, we take reasonable steps to ensure the recipient is subject to a law, binding agreement, or contractual terms that provide an adequate level of protection substantially similar to POPIA before any information is transferred.

9. Data Retention

We retain personal information for as long as your account (or the tenant account you are linked to) remains active. After account termination, we aim to delete personal information we no longer have a legitimate business need to hold within a reasonable period, and you may request an export of your data before it is deleted. We may retain information for longer where required by law, for example financial records for tax purposes.
